Historic summer for Welsh stars

As the curtain came down on the Paris 2024 Olympic & Paralympic Games, it brought an end to a historic summer for Welsh swimmers. For the first time, Welsh athletes earned gold medals at both Games, with Kieran Bird & Matt Richards clinching 4x200m Freestyle Relay gold, and Rhys Darbey playing a pivotal role in […]

Darbey storms to back to clinch silver!

Rhys Darbey mounted a stunning comeback to add the SM14 200m Individual Medley silver medal to his relay gold at the 2024 Paralympic Games. The 17-year-old stormed home to a lifetime best of 2:08.61 at La Defense Arena to take the Welsh medal tally in Paris to five. Trailing the leading pack after the opening […]

Richards and Bird crowned Olympic Champions

Welshmen Matthew Richards and Kieran Bird were crowned Olympic champions after Team GB made history by defending their Men’s 4x200m Freestyle title. Richards, who won a sensational individual silver on Monday, swum a rapid third leg in the final after Bird helped Great Britain secure the fastest qualifying spot for the final after La Défense […]

Matthew Richards: Olympic Profile

Matthew Richards became Wales’ first Olympic swimming gold medallist in more than a century alongside Calum Jarvis in 2021, and now his sights are set on individual honours. The 21-year-old Richards reached the pinnacle of his sport at the age of 18, winning Olympic gold as part of the men’s 4x200m relay team in Tokyo, […]
